Proverbs 29 Cross References - KJ2000

1 He, that being often reproved hardens his neck, shall suddenly be destroyed, and that without remedy. 2 When the righteous are in authority, the people rejoice: but when the wicked bears rule, the people mourn. 3 Whosoever loves wisdom rejoices his father: but he that keeps company with harlots wastes his substance. 4 The king by justice establishes the land: but he that receives bribes overthrows it. 5 A man that flatters his neighbor spreads a net for his feet. 6 In the transgression of an evil man there is a snare: but the righteous does sing and rejoice. 7 The righteous considers the cause of the poor: but the wicked regards not such knowledge. 8 Scornful men bring a city into a snare: but wise men turn away wrath. 9 If a wise man contends with a foolish man, whether the foolish man rages or laughs, there is no rest. 10 The bloodthirsty hate the upright: but the just seek his good. 11 A fool utters all his mind: but a wise man keeps it in till afterwards. 12 If a ruler hearkens to lies, all his servants are wicked. 13 The poor and the deceitful man meet together: the LORD lightens both their eyes. 14 The king that faithfully judges the poor, his throne shall be established forever. 15 The rod and reproof give wisdom: but a child left to himself brings his mother to shame. 16 When the wicked are multiplied, transgression increases: but the righteous shall see their fall. 17 Correct your son, and he shall give you rest; yea, he shall give delight unto your soul. 18 Where there is no vision, the people perish: but he that keeps the law, happy is he. 19 A servant will not be corrected by words: for though he understands he will not answer. 20 See you a man that is hasty in his words? there is more hope for a fool than for him. 21 He that carefully brings up his servant from a child shall have him become his son in the end. 22 An angry man stirs up strife, and a furious man abounds in transgression. 23 A man's pride shall bring him low: but honor shall uphold the humble in spirit. 24 Whosoever is partner with a thief hates his own soul: he hears cursing, and reveals it not. 25 The fear of man brings a snare: but whosoever puts his trust in the LORD shall be safe. 26 Many seek the ruler's favor; but every man's judgment comes from the LORD. 27 An unjust man is an abomination to the just: and he that is upright in the way is abomination to the wicked.
